Sushi is one of my many passions. Being a Tallahassee native, I've definitely made my way around the sushi scene in town.

I can truthfully say that I don't have a favorite restaurant...it's like picking a favorite child! But that's the beauty of sushi. It's almost ALWAYS amazing, and will make your taste buds dance with joy. Do yourself a favor and try out these sushi shops!

1. Sakura.


Two words: volcano roll. It's served literally on fire...so yeah, I'd say it's a must-have.

2. Jasmine Cafe.


Jasmine's not only featured on Neighbors and Friends (eek,) but is actually delicious! With the restaurant being located downtown, it's super convenient for college students.

3. Kiku Japanese Fusion.

Kiku has a buy one get one free special every day of the week, making sushi always a cost-effective choice.

4. Siam Sushi.

Siam offers a Trust Me roll, where the chef makes whatever kind of roll they feel like making and you have to...trust them! Get it. Trust the chefs. They're amazing.

5. Masa.

A sushi boat at Masa is literally just a MASSIVE amount of sushi in a picture-perfect wooden boat. What an INCREDIBLE CONCEPT. A perfect date idea...or just eat it all yourself. Absolutely no shame in that.

6. Izzy Pub & Sushi.

Go to Izzy's for lunch Monday through Saturday, and get 3 sushi rolls, soup, and a salad for only $15! What a deal. Yet another excuse to make sushi your #1 lunch choice.

7. Bento Asian Kitchen.

There are few things in life that beat a Bento Box, am I right? Bento is located extremely close to campus, and basically everyone's favorite fast-food sushi.
